OTHA 1241 - Occupational Performance from Birth through Adolescence


Credit Hours: 2
Contact Hours - Lecture: 1 Lab: 4
Occupational performance of newborns through adolescents. Includes frames of reference, evaluation tools and techniques, and intervention strategies.
Prerequisite: College Level Readiness in Reading AND Writing; OTHA 1315  and PSYC 2314  
Student Learning Outcomes
1 - Identify components of health and wellness. 2 - Develop adaptations for age appropriate occupations. 3 - Identify the client factors that affect occupational performance. 4 - Demonstrate skills in the evaluation process. 5 - Select intervention strategies to facilitate occupational performance.
